What Professional Lawn Maintenance Entails
Expert lawn maintenance services in North Providence typically encompass a comprehensive suite of tasks designed to keep your turf lush, green, and resilient throughout the seasons. These services go far beyond simple mowing, addressing the complex needs of your lawn.
Core Lawn Maintenance Services
Mowing and Trimming: Regular, precise mowing at optimal heights to encourage healthy growth and prevent stress. This includes trimming around beds, fences, and walkways for a clean, finished look.
Edging: Creating crisp, defined borders between your lawn and garden beds, sidewalks, and driveways to enhance visual appeal and prevent grass encroachment.
Fertilization and Soil>conditioning: Applying custom-blended fertilizers based on soil testing and the specific needs of your grass type to provide essential nutrients for strong roots and vibrant green color. Promoting healthy soil pH is crucial in New England’s often acidic soil conditions.
Weed Control: Implementing both pre-emergent and post-emergent strategies to effectively manage and prevent a wide range of common lawn weeds, ensuring your grass isn’t competing for vital resources.
Pest and Disease Management: Identifying and treating common lawn pests and diseases that can damage turf, using targeted and effective solutions.
Aeration: Creating small holes in the soil to improve air circulation, water penetration, and nutrient uptake, particularly important for compacted soils often found in developed areas.
Overseeding: Introducing new grass seed into existing turf to thicken the lawn, fill in bare spots, and improve its overall density and resilience.
Leaf Removal: Clearing fallen leaves, especially in autumn, to prevent smothering the grass and allowing moisture and sunlight to reach the turf.

Frequently Asked Questions about Lawn Maintenance in North Providence
When is the best time to start essential lawn maintenance tasks in North Providence?
For North Providence, the prime time to begin comprehensive lawn maintenance typically starts in early spring, around March or April, as soon as the ground is workable and temperatures begin to consistently rise. This is the ideal period for initial fertilization, aeration, and overseeding to prepare your lawn for the growing season. Consistent mowing should commence once the grass actively starts growing, usually a few weeks after the first fertilization. Fall is also a crucial period for late-season fertilization and leaf removal to ensure your lawn remains healthy through the winter and is better prepared for the following spring.
How do local lawn maintenance professionals handle the specific climate and common North Providence housing styles?
Local professionals are acutely aware of Rhode Island’s climate fluctuations, including the potential for drought stress in summer and the impact of heavy snow and ice in winter. They tailor fertilization schedules to provide nutrients when grass needs them most and adjust mowing heights based on seasonal conditions. Regarding North Providence housing styles, they understand how to navigate and maintain lawns around various property layouts, including managing turf in smaller urban yards common in older neighborhoods as well as the larger expanses of more suburban areas. They also consider factors like shade from mature trees often found on established properties.

Growing Season & Service Timing
North Providence has 5,254 annual heating degree days and 769 cooling degree days, indicating a relatively short active season — typically May through September — with hard winters that demand cold-hardy plant selection and late-spring service starts. Timing landscaping services correctly for North Providence's specific climate improves results significantly — especially for lawn overseeding, fertilization, and tree pruning, each of which has an optimal window tied to local frost dates and turf dormancy. Source: Open-Meteo ERA5 Climate Reanalysis, 2014–2023 average.

What Lawn Maintenance Involves
Lawn care typically begins with a soil test (pH, nutrients) to target treatment accurately; aeration breaks up compaction so water and nutrients reach roots; overseeding fills thin areas with matching or improved grass varieties; fertilization is timed to the grass type (cool-season or warm-season)

When is the best time to schedule Lawn Maintenance in North Providence?
Based on North Providence's climate data, spring (April–May) is the primary window for turf renovation; fall is ideal for overseeding cool-season grasses. Summer heat limits some services.
Can I do Lawn Maintenance myself?
Mowing and basic edging are DIY tasks most homeowners handle; aeration and overseeding require rented equipment but are manageable for a motivated DIYer; soil testing and proper fertilizer selection take research to get right
